Taking The Action To A Higher Address

The blood of animals could only cover sin. Jesus' blood erases sin! We sometimes speak of the "Atonement," meaning Christ's sacrifice, but a better word is Propitiation. It means that, by the death of our Substitute, our debt of sin is paid, and God's wrath is turned away. As we start a new week with a new sermon, the author of Hebrews continues to hammer his point: that the old sacrificial system was a mere shadow of what Jesus has done for us.

God's Little Theater

Sometimes you have to keep telling yourself, "It's only a movie!" We can get caught up in a drama and forget that what we're seeing is a story, designed by a playwright and performed by actors who have other names and other lives. As we open Hebrews 9 we'll see a unique drama. The divine Author used it to communicate His "inner life," if you will, to us. The stage was the Tabernacle; the players were priests; and the meaning of the presentation is what we'll discuss today. But never forget - as some of the early Jewish Christians did - that "it's only a movie."

Meet Mysterious Melchizedek

Is Abraham our spiritual great-great grandfather? Or might it be someone "greater?" There is someone "greater than Abraham" in the Old Testament. His name is Melchizedek. We don't know much about who he was, but we can see what he stood for. And, for those Hebrew Christians tempted to fall back into the Jewish system, he is a powerful symbol of something better, deeper, and permanent. Our quick Hebrews series has brought us to chapter 7. The Ultimate Insider

Job cried, "For He is not a man, as I am, that I may answer Him, and that we should go to court together. Nor is there any mediator between us, who may lay his hand on us both." We're back in the book of Hebrews for a new series, but I quoted Job because he stated the problem perfectly: Any arbitrator between God and man would have to understand the viewpoint of a perfect being, and also understand the viewpoint of - well, us. We need The Ultimate Insider.
